Abstract(in English) | We propose a method that optimizes coding rate and distortion of JPEG via sparse representation. However, in this optimization, evaluating the coding rate is generally difficult to solve. Instead, in our previous method, we seek to minimize the weighted sum of l_0-norm of DCT coefficients and distortion(MSE) using Don't Care Region and Transform Domain Bounding Box Strategy. In this paper, we proposed a new method for automatically estimating Lagrange parameter that controls the relative importance of rate to distortion using quality parameter and DCT coefficients. Experimental results showed that our method outperformed unoptimized JPEG compression by up to 9.1% in coding rate. |
